What you’ll learn

What each unit actually teaches you to do

These are the units City & Guilds Limited registers against this qualification. It is a catalogue, not a syllabus. Which of them you take depends on the combination the qualification requires, and that is set by the awarding body rather than by us. Every unit here is regulated, and every one you earn is yours to keep.

Conduct auditing processes in cleaningRe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Understand the cleaning processes and the standards of performance required and how they must be implemented
  • Implement auditing processes for cleaning
  • Evaluate and report on the results of the cleaning audit
Green Cleaning methods and practicesRe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Understand green cleaning methods and practices and the effect they have on their job role
  • Conduct cleaning tasks using green cleaning methods and practices
Introduction to Team LeadingRe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Understand effective team leadership in the cleaning industry
  • Plan and organise the work of a team to meet team objectives
  • Check the performance and give feedback to team and individuals
Prepare and pressure clean porous or non-porous surfacesRe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Prepare to pressure clean porous or non porous surfaces
  • Pressure clean porous or non-porous surfaces
  • Re-instate area after pressure cleaning
Prepare and carry out cosmetic cleaning of carpetsRe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Prepare for the cosmetic / maintenance cleaning of carpets
  • Carry out cosmetic / maintenance carpet cleaning
  • Reinstate area
Prepare and deep clean carpetsRe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Identify carpet type and select an appropriate deep cleaning method
  • Prepare for the deep cleaning of carpets
  • Deep clean carpets
  • Reinstate area
Prepare and remove hazardous items at a trauma sceneRe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Prepare handling and segregating hazardous items for a trauma scene
  • Handle and segregate hazardous items at a trauma scene
  • Remove hazardous items from a trauma scene
Prepare to work in the cleaning industryRe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Prepare self and work area
  • Know the requirements for disposal and storage of personal protective equipment
  • Prepare cleaning agents and materials safely
  • Dispose of and store cleaning agents and materials safely
  • Use equipment and machines safely
  • Store equipment and machines safely
Prepare, clean and dispose of bodily fluids at a trauma sceneRe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Prepare to clean bodily fluids from the trauma scene
  • Clean bodily fluids at a trauma scene
  • Dispose of bodily fluids and reinstate area
Prepare, strip and apply emulsion floor polishRe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Prepare for the stripping and application of emulsion floor polish
  • Strip emulsion floor polish
  • Apply emulsion floor polish and reinstate area
Training of cleaning operativesReal unit · City & Guilds Limited

What you'll be able to do

  • Understand the importance of training in the cleaning industry
  • Identify training needs and select the appropriate training methods for the operative
  • Train the operative effectively
  • Provide and record feedback for the operative
  • Evaluate the effectiveness of their training to the operative
